How do you make a draw effect in Illustrator?

How do you make a draw effect in Illustrator?

Choose Effect > Stylize > Scribble….Create a sketch using the Scribble effect

  1. Select the object or group (or target a layer in the Layers panel).
  2. To apply the effect to a specific object attribute, such as a stroke or fill, select the object, and then select the attribute in the Appearance panel.

Is there a pencil tool in Illustrator?

The Pencil tool, found by pressing the Paintbrush tool in the Toolbar, is for creating more free-form paths—similar to drawing on paper with a pencil.

Should I use Photoshop or Illustrator to draw?

Photoshop is easier to draw, Illustrator is easier to edit and make changes later on. Illustrator being a vector-based program has a learning curve. You will need to learn how to use the pen tool and other tools for drawing circles and curves, which has different techniques than with a brush tool in Photoshop.

How do you draw a cupcake casing in illustrator?

For the cupcake casing, I used the Line Segment Tool (\\) to draw each with a black 0.75pt Stroke Weight. I started in the center to split it in half, then quarters and then eighths. Once your line art is done, select all of the elements and Group them up (Command + G). Then use the Live Paint Bucket (K) to fill each one of the shapes.
